In this episode, Bill Peters discusses the recently announced Australian Test squad for the 1st Test of the Ashes series, analysing player selections, surprises, and the implications for the team's performance. He delves into the fast bowling options, batting lineup challenges, and the role of Cameron Green and how it impacts the balance of the team and the playing chances of other members of the squad. He also gives his opinion on the different selections he would have made, and his forthright opinions on the possibilities that may occur in two weeks time.
Takeaways
The Australian Test squad has been officially announced.
Cameron Green's fitness is crucial for the batting lineup.
Beau Webster's performance warrants his inclusion in the team.
Fergus O'Neill's omission raises concerns about future fast bowlers.
The selectors may disrupt the batting order for Cameron Green.
Jake Weatherald's form justifies his selection as an opener.
The fast bowling lineup is under scrutiny due to injuries.
The WBBL is set to begin, showcasing top female cricketers.
Pat Cummins' injury status will impact team dynamics.
Future selections should prioritise players in form., not jobs for the boys.
